Kanban app is a visual project management software that implements the kanban methodology. It allows users to create boards with columns representing workflow stages, add cards to represent tasks, and move the cards across columns to indicate progress. Useful for agile teams practicing lean workflows.

Visual Studio Code is a free, open-source, lightweight code editor developed by Microsoft. It supports debugging, syntax highlighting, intelligent code completion, and Git control. VS Code has a large extension ecosystem allowing developers to add new languages, themes, debuggers and tools.
